Erigeron sumatrensis Retz. (Compositae), a recently recognized invasive alien species in Bosnia and Herzegovina

Sažetak

Erigeron sumatrensis Retz. is native in South America, widely naturalized in Europe and has been recently recorded in Bosnia and Herzegovina. During the period of 2019-2020, it was recorded at 35 new localities in South Herzegovina and Central Bosnia. On the basis of the number of populations and the numbers of individuals within populations, we assume that this species is now invasive in Bosnia and Herzegovina.
